LG Stylo 3 was officially unveiled back in December and made its first public appearance at Consumer Electronics Show (CES) in early January, where it was showcased alongside the new K series mid-range smartphones.

Today, Sprint announced the LG Stylo 3 is available for purchase at Boost Mobile and Virgin Mobile for just $179.99 (plus tax). Customers don't need to sign up for a long-term contract, but they can choose one of Boost or Virgin Mobile's unlimited plans.

Judging by the specs list, the LG Stylo 3 offers more bang for the buck than most smartphones in the same price range. First off, the handset runs Android 7.0 Nougat right out of the box.

Also, it comes equipped with a 1.4GHz octa-core processor, coupled with 2GB RAM and 16GB of expandable memory. Moreover, LG Stylo 3 boasts a large 5.7-inch display with HD (720p) resolution, but also a stylus.

On the back side, there's a 13-megapixel camera with LED flash, as well as a fingerprint sensor. A secondary 5-megapixel camera for selfies and video calls is featured on the front side. According to Sprint, the 3,200 mAh battery powering the LG Stylo 3 should provide up to 25 hours of talk time.

Of course, you also get a range of LG distinctive features like QuickMemo+, Pen Keeper, Enhanced Stylus, Comfort Mode, Pop Scanner, Capture+, and many others.
